The Basque PP will hold the congress in Vitoria-Gasteiz on November 4 to appoint the successor to its current president, Carlos Iturgaiz.

The date of the congress was announced by Iturgaiz himself on Wednesday in a speech to the Basque PP Board of Directors, which was attended by the Deputy Secretary of the Territorial Organization of the Popular Party, Miguel Tellado.

The organizing committee of the congress that will appoint Iturgaiz’s replacement will be chaired by Álava PP president Iñaki Oyarzabal and will take place on November 4 in Vitoria-Gasteiz.

In statements to the media before taking part in the meeting of the Board of Directors of the PP of Euskadi in Vitoria-Gasteiz, he avoided commenting on whether he will ultimately be a candidate to lead the formation in the next regional congress preside.

“Today is the day of Carlos Iturgaiz, who is the one who will explain to us the details of the congress and he will also have to explain what his own future is. So today we are going to listen to him,” he emphasized.

In any case, he has chosen to present “a single candidacy” to “whoever” the candidate is. “That would be good for everyone,” emphasized the former deputy general of Álava and former delegate of the Spanish government in Euskadi.

As reported today by sources from the Basque PP, De Andrés is the candidate proposed by Génova, which has decided that the Congress of the Basque People’s Parties will take place in Vitoria-Gasteiz. editinstead of with previously elected delegates.

The former deputy general of Álava and deputy of the government in the Basque Country will be allowed to form the leadership of the Basque PP, in which the people of Biscay want to see their ‘specific weight’ reflected by occupying ‘number 2’, the Secretariat General, to which they will make a proposal Eduardo Andradethe current Secretary General of the PP of Bizkaia and spokesperson in Getxo.
